A FEW NOTES ABOUT THE AUTHOR
WILLIAM GOLDING


William Golding was born in Cornwall in 1911. He attended Oxford where he began as a science major but later changed his major to English literature. During World War II, he joined the Royal Navy and achieved the rank of lieutenant. He participated in both the Walcheren and D-Day campaigns.Following the war, he began to teach and write.

Some of his works include: Lord of the Flies, The Inheritors, and Pincher Martin.

William Golding died of heart failure on June 19, 1993.
